
Mkhwanazi, five others face court again over Mbense killing
The bail application of suspended Ekurhuleni Metro Police Department (EMPD) Deputy Chief Julius Mkhwanazi and five co-accused is expected to continue at the Brakpan Magistrate’s Court on the East Rand on Thursday.
The atate is opposing bail, raising concerns that if the accused are released, remaining witnesses may not survive until the trial.
The investigating officer has also questioned the accused’s version of events surrounding Mbense’s death.
